Abstract
The invention discloses a kind of efficient multiple step format tea oil filter devices, including Rose Box and settling tank, the inner cavity of Rose Box is equipped with the first filter screen, the second filter screen and isolation board successively from left to right, shaft is equipped in Rose Box, one end of shaft passes through the first filter screen and is fixedly connected with and the matched cleaning brush of the second filter screen, the bottom wall of Rose Box sets that there are two the mudholes coordinated respectively with the first filter screen and the second filter screen, the bottom end of Rose Box is fixedly connected with dregs of fat case, the top left hand perforation connection oil inlet pipe of Rose Box;It is equipped with stirring rod in settling tank, is uniformly equipped with several connecting rods on stirring rod, the other end of connecting rod is hinged the first paddle;The present invention is filtered crude oil by the way that the first filter screen and the second filter screen is arranged, and impurity and other solid particulate matters in tea oil is discharged;The setting of settling tank is further precipitated to filtered fluid, is ensured that the impurity of tea oil is completely removed, is ensured the quality of tea oil.

Background technology
Camellia seed oil is commonly called as tea oil also known as camellia oil, camellia seed oil, be from the C. olelferas of Theaceae Camellia Plants at
The pure natural high edible vegetable oil extracted in ripe seed, golden yellow color or pale yellow, quality is pure, clear, smell faint scent,
Good taste.Oil tea is commonly called as camellia, wild tea, white flower tea, is a kind of distinctive high quality food oil tannin plant of China.Oil tea and tealeaves
Not of the same race to belong to, the vegetable oil that the seed that they are tied is squeezed out is entirely different, the former is known as camellia seed oil, and the latter is known as
90% or more of tea seed oil whole world camellia seed oil yield is from China.When B.C. more than 100 years Emperors Wu Di of the Han dynasty, China just opens
Begin plantation oil tea, has more than 2000 years history so far.It is grown in the natural no dirt in southern china subtropical zone moist climate area
The high mountain of dye and hilly country, a province can plant more than 10, and major production areas saves (area) in Hunan, Jiangxi, Guangxi of China etc., entirely
About 45,000,000 mu of the existing cultivated area of state produces 1000000 tons of tea seed, 270,000 tons of oil-producing tea-seed oil per year.Tea oil is that Chinese Government carries
The pure natural woody edible vegetable oil of popularization is advocated, and the health care vegetable edible oil that international food and agricultural organization is first-elected.
Traditional tea oil filter plant efficiency is low, because of the special nature of tea oil, the time is longer, and color is easier to be deepened,
So the tea oil inferior quality that traditional filter type obtains, it is therefore necessary to fast filtering, to ensure its color and luster, while tea oil
Because its unique viscosity is but also filtering is very difficult, purity is not often still up to standard after often filtering.

The present invention is in use, the crude oil after squeezing is entered by oil inlet pipe 16 in Rose Box 1, and crude oil is through the first filter screen 3
It is filtered with the second filter screen 4, filters out the impurity and other solid particulate matters, these impurity and solid particulate matter in crude oil
It is fallen down from the first filter screen 3 and the second filter screen 4 under the action of cleaning brush 8, and the dregs of fat is entered by mudhole 15
The dregs of fat can be effectively discharged in case 12 in time, while the first filter screen 3 and the second filter screen 4 can effectively be prevented to be blocked, and ensure
Equipment is in good operating status always, and filtered fluid enters in settling tank 2, and the second motor 22 drives the first paddle
24 and 25 high speed rotation of the second paddle, tiny particulate matter, ensures the quality of tea oil in high speed pellets, the fluid after precipitation from
Flowline 29 is discharged.
